The Roiling Body Politic

By Steven Beschloss

Across the country, over 2,000 pro-Palestinian protestors have faced arrest on dozens of college campuses, causing turmoil and flashes of violence as the schools prepare for graduation. At the risk of suspension, expulsion and felony charges, many of these stud

